Lines Matching refs:OP

7019 #define zend_ffi_expr_math(val, op2, OP) do { \  argument
7023 val->u64 = val->u64 OP op2->u64; \
7025 val->u64 = val->u64 OP op2->i64; \
7027 val->u64 = val->u64 OP op2->i64; \
7030 val->d = (zend_ffi_double)val->u64 OP op2->d; \
7032 val->u64 = val->u64 OP op2->ch; \
7038 val->i64 = val->i64 OP op2->u64; \
7040 val->i64 = val->i64 OP op2->u64; \
7043 val->i64 = val->i64 OP op2->i64; \
7046 val->d = (zend_ffi_double)val->i64 OP op2->d; \
7048 val->i64 = val->i64 OP op2->ch; \
7054 val->d = val->d OP (zend_ffi_double)op2->u64; \
7056 val->d = val->d OP (zend_ffi_double)op2->i64; \
7059 val->d = val->d OP op2->d; \
7061 val->d = val->d OP (zend_ffi_double)op2->ch; \
7068 val->u64 = val->ch OP op2->u64; \
7071 val->i64 = val->ch OP op2->i64; \
7074 val->d = (zend_ffi_double)val->ch OP op2->d; \
7076 val->ch = val->ch OP op2->ch; \
7085 #define zend_ffi_expr_int_math(val, op2, OP) do { \ argument
7089 val->u64 = val->u64 OP op2->u64; \
7091 val->u64 = val->u64 OP op2->i64; \
7093 val->u64 = val->u64 OP op2->i64; \
7095 val->u64 = val->u64 OP (uint64_t)op2->d; \
7097 val->u64 = val->u64 OP op2->ch; \
7103 val->i64 = val->i64 OP op2->u64; \
7105 val->i64 = val->i64 OP op2->u64; \
7108 val->i64 = val->i64 OP op2->i64; \
7110 val->u64 = val->u64 OP (int64_t)op2->d; \
7112 val->i64 = val->i64 OP op2->ch; \
7119 val->u64 = (uint64_t)val->d OP op2->u64; \
7122 val->i64 = (int64_t)val->d OP op2->i64; \
7129 val->u64 = (uint64_t)val->ch OP op2->u64; \
7132 val->i64 = (int64_t)val->ch OP op2->u64; \
7134 val->ch = val->ch OP op2->ch; \
7143 #define zend_ffi_expr_cmp(val, op2, OP) do { \ argument
7147 val->i64 = val->u64 OP op2->u64; \
7150 val->i64 = val->u64 OP op2->u64; /*signed/unsigned */ \
7153 val->i64 = (zend_ffi_double)val->u64 OP op2->d; \
7156 val->i64 = val->u64 OP op2->d; \
7163 val->i64 = val->i64 OP op2->i64; /* signed/unsigned */ \
7166 val->i64 = val->i64 OP op2->i64; \
7169 val->i64 = (zend_ffi_double)val->i64 OP op2->d; \
7172 val->i64 = val->i64 OP op2->ch; \
7179 val->i64 = val->d OP (zend_ffi_double)op2->u64; \
7182 val->i64 = val->d OP (zend_ffi_double)op2->i64; \
7185 val->i64 = val->d OP op2->d; \
7188 val->i64 = val->d OP (zend_ffi_double)op2->ch; \
7195 val->i64 = val->ch OP op2->i64; /* signed/unsigned */ \
7198 val->i64 = val->ch OP op2->i64; \
7201 val->i64 = (zend_ffi_double)val->ch OP op2->d; \
7204 val->i64 = val->ch OP op2->ch; \